Now I’ll discuss concerning the Japanese optical business and the way these flatteners are altering the face of the way in which enterprise is completed on this business.
A very powerful flatteners affecting the optical business at this time
The biggest marketplace for eyeglasses is the U.S. and from an optical business perspective (maybe others as effectively), America appears solely to need “cheaper” merchandise. This want for “worth down” (on the expense of high quality) has pushed a considerable amount of enterprise to China. The producers in China produce acceptable high quality at a dramatically diminished worth in comparison with the remainder of the world. Japan had the aggressive benefit of with the ability to work titanium and titanium alloy supplies that are in excessive demand for eyeglasses on the earth. As a result of “no nickel” coverage in Europe loads of the “normal metals” are being phased out and titanium, being thought of “nickel-free” has grow to be a sizzling commodity.
Japanese manufacturing may be very top quality (the remainder of the world can’t attain the standard of the producers right here for eyeglasses), but additionally very costly as a result of on this little business, we don’t use production-line manufacturing. Though everybody would favor the Japanese high quality, the value level has pushed them away to China.
Many Japanese producers went bankrupt and those who survived both did so as a result of they moved to area of interest manufacturing for a smaller market, or they OUTSOURCED their manufacturing to corporations in China. Outsourcing to China for the Japanese market has been very tough as a result of, though Friedman talks about “top quality manufacturing in China”, I’ve to disagree for the optical business. The poor high quality that comes out of Chinese language factories, and the way in which enterprise is performed is extraordinarily irritating to corporations outsourcing their orders to corporations there.
As a way to overcome this, the businesses that might afford to take action have began OFFSHORING their enterprise by both constructing their very own factories in China and managing themselves, or working with an present Chinese language producer however sending Japanese individuals over to handle the manufacturing of their product.
Outsourcing isn’t a brand new idea in optical manufacturing in Japan. There actually are only a few precise producers of eyeglasses who do the complete course of from A to Z. The Japanese system is such that everybody makes use of smaller corporations specializing in one or a number of of the 200 steps required to make the frames (brazing, plating, portray, sharpening, forming, and so on.). Part of an order goes out, is accomplished and comes again to the corporate who sends it out for the subsequent course of. This is quite common on this business.
Nevertheless, doing the complete course of abroad was very tough for this business. It has grow to be vital, and important for survival for the body producers with out a manufacturing aggressive benefit. They want a worth benefit in an effort to survive.
Within the optical business offshoring their whole course of by way of creating a brand new manufacturing facility in a overseas land in an effort to compete is a really new mind-set for the producers / suppliers of eyeglasses to the worldwide market.
How these forces have an effect on/affect the business technique
This necessity has affected the businesses dramatically and compelled them to do one in all two issues:
i) Transfer deeper into a distinct segment market to take care of manufacturing in Japan at a better worth, however producing a product that’s specialised and can’t be copied or produced on the mass market of Chinese language manufacturing. These frames are far more costly than these made in China (on the retail market) because of the markup system of eyewear in Japan. The producers right here have additionally needed to minimize their margins in an effort to promote Made in Japan product despite the area of interest market they’re in as a result of the massive distinction of mass-produced Chinese language frames diluting the market has invariably pushed the worth of Japanese high quality down, regardless of it’s superior high quality.
ii) Settle for a decrease high quality product at a cheaper price level to take a bigger market share. This has been powerful for the Japanese corporations concerned on this enterprise, nevertheless evidently the “Japanese demand increased high quality” exterior remark doesn’t maintain totally true for this market (or that of different merchandise after wanting on the market main shift to “Made in China” items). Those who capitalized on this reality had been the primary to enter the “three worth eyeglass market” and took an enormous revenue from it. They adjusted their technique to buy offshore by way of OEMs in China fairly than make them in Japan on the increased costs.
One other attention-grabbing impact of this alteration is that even in Europe, the “origin” of eyeglass producers, manufacturing in Europe is now not a worthwhile possibility. Europe didn’t put money into titanium, or area of interest manufacturing so when the Chinese language discovered from Japan learn how to work the fabric, Europe might now not make something that the Chinese language couldn’t make at a fraction of the price. My companion/buyer in France who used to purchase my supplies can now not purchase them as a result of the entire producers have stopped making eyeglasses in France. They’ve needed to utterly change their technique to survive and as an alternative of producing their very own frames now, use their deep understanding of vogue and design to attract up product and have them made in China, which they order by way of corporations like my affiliate, who’ve connections with producers.
Modifications within the business construction which will enhance an organization’s aggressive place
Since this course of has been happening for the previous a number of years, the construction has slowly been altering such that lower-end product (or “normal” we might now say as a result of high quality has positively improved over the previous a number of years) is manufactured in China by way of outsourcing to Chinese language factories or offshoring by an organization’s personal manufacturing facility abroad, whereas the higher-end product is saved in Japan, manufactured within the conventional means of outsourcing to the specialists which are proficient within the specific features. This has polarized the business and created a really completely different market section for the businesses to focus on.
The businesses which have chosen to stay in Japan are discovering that as time has progressed, abroad purchasers as effectively are coming again to a higher-end product as a result of they discover that high quality actually does make a distinction in revenue margin. There’s a new shift which is rewarding these niche-market gamers with a rise in orders for increased high quality product.
One other change which will enhance an organization’s aggressive place is to find out whether or not or not it may provide product in each ranges, outsourcing the decrease/standard-end fashions for the purchasers requesting it, and preserving the upper finish / particular product “in home” (in nation). This requires creating relations with different corporations which have connections to such abroad producers (as in France).
China does have a particular comparative benefit when it comes to economies of scale. Initially when an organization needed to position an order with a Chinese language firm they might get an amazing worth, however had been required to order a ridiculous quantity of product, like 10,000 frames! No person in Japan might try this so it was extraordinarily tough. Ultimately the Chinese language corporations re-worked their manufacturing strains (similar to any firm around the globe in an effort to get extra orders) to fulfill the wants of the purchasers who couldn’t order such giant quantities. Over the previous 5 years these numbers have dramatically decreased from tens of 1000’s, to 1000’s and now even to a whole bunch. That is placing an actual pinch on the Japanese optical market in addition to the opposite producers around the globe who might as soon as get orders on “small amount”. Now China has positioned themselves to take even THAT market. This alteration has most positively improved the aggressive AND comparative place of the Chinese language producers.
The “dealer” system within the optical business may be very well-liked for a number of causes: the Japanese corporations have relied on importers/exporters a lot that most of the small to mid-size gamers don’t have the capability or understanding for import/export to carry out in-house. In addition they are infamous for lack of English ability. Along with this, yet one more issue is their concern of “gathering cost from overseas”.
Due to these elements many corporations are afraid to do outsourcing immediately. They want the enterprise so contract brokers to do the work / take the danger on their behalf. This after all drives up the value as a result of brokers are recognized to take a excessive margin on this business. I consider {that a} change on this mentality, a greater understanding of the worldwide business and a greater command of worldwide enterprise is crucial for producers in Japan to take full benefit of the low-cost of acceptable Chinese language product and mix it with their aggressive benefit of sustaining their area of interest manufacturing within the high-quality market section.
Having mentioned all of that, the truth that China is now capable of manufacture nearly all of low to medium price/high quality eyeglass frames for Japan (for the world), this may enable the low profitability on these merchandise (in Japan) to be bypassed and producers can as an alternative concentrate on increased revenue margin areas of the market. In the long run, the those who need low cost glasses can get them, and those who need costly glasses may get them. The entire market surplus from this new type of enterprise is optimistic and outweighs the lower in producer surplus as a result of the buyer surplus is larger than the lack of producer surplus. The market wins.
